5.1.3 Fisheye View
The device supports the fisheye expansion for the connected fisheye camera in live view or
playback mode.
●
The connected camera must support the fisheye view.
●
iDS-9600NXI-I8/4F(B) series do not support fisheye view.
Step 1 In the live view mode, click the to enter the fisheye expansion mode.
Step 2 Select the expansion view mode.
● 180° Panorama ( ): Switch the live view image to the 180° panorama view.
● 360° Panorama ( ): Switch the live view image to the 360° panorama view.
● PTZ Expansion ( ): The PTZ Expansion is the close-up view of some defined area in the
fisheye view or panorama expansion, and it supports the electronic PTZ function, which is also
called e-PTZ.
● Radial Expansion ( ): In the radial expansion mode, the whole wide-angle view of the
fisheye camera is displayed. This view mode is called Fisheye View because it approximates
the vision of a fish’s convex eye. The lens produces curvilinear images of a large area, while
distorting the perspective and angles of objects in the image.
